Discord, as many of you may know, is a popular platform for communication among gamers and other communities. It offers features like voice calls, text chats, and screen sharing to facilitate smooth and convenient interaction. But have you ever wondered how Discord manages to provide such high-quality audio in real-time? Well, that’s where the audio subsystem of Discord comes into play.
As an avid gamer and a tech enthusiast, I have always been fascinated by the technical aspects of online communication platforms. So, today, I will take you on a journey to explore what exactly the audio subsystem of Discord is, how it works, and why it is so crucial for an immersive user experience.
Understanding the Audio Subsystem
The audio subsystem of Discord is responsible for handling all the audio-related tasks within the application. It ensures that your voice calls are clear, your friends’ voices are crystal clear, and all the sounds in the background are transmitted with minimal latency and distortion.
Discord utilizes a combination of advanced audio codecs, network protocols, and sophisticated algorithms to deliver top-notch audio quality. The audio subsystem is designed to prioritize voice communication to ensure that your voice is heard loud and clear, even in the midst of intense gaming sessions.
How Does It Work?
At its core, the audio subsystem of Discord takes advantage of a technology called Opus. Opus is an open-source audio codec that provides excellent compression efficiency and low latency, making it ideal for real-time communication applications like Discord.
When you speak into your microphone on Discord, your voice is captured and encoded using the Opus codec. The encoded voice data is then encapsulated into a series of network packets and sent to the Discord servers. These servers act as intermediaries, relaying the packets to the recipients of your voice call.
On the receiving end, the audio subsystem decodes the voice packets and plays them back through the user’s speakers or headphones. The Opus codec ensures that the audio quality remains high, even with the compression applied to minimize bandwidth usage.
Optimizing Audio Quality
To further enhance the audio quality, Discord employs various techniques and optimizations:
- Echo Cancellation: Discord’s audio subsystem includes advanced echo cancellation algorithms to eliminate any feedback or echo caused by your microphone picking up sounds from your speakers.
- Noise Suppression: Background noise can be a distraction during voice calls. Discord uses noise suppression algorithms to filter out background noise and focus on transmitting only the clear voice of the speaker.
- Automatic Gain Control: The audio subsystem adjusts the gain levels dynamically to ensure a consistent volume level for all participants, even if someone speaks softly or loudly.
The audio subsystem of Discord plays a crucial role in providing users with a seamless and immersive communication experience. By leveraging advanced audio codecs, network protocols, and intelligent algorithms, Discord ensures that your voice is heard clearly, and the background sounds are minimized. These optimizations, such as echo cancellation and noise suppression, further enhance the audio quality and make Discord a go-to platform for gamers and communities alike.
So, the next time you join a voice call on Discord, take a moment to appreciate the technology behind it, the audio subsystem working silently in the background to deliver crisp and clear audio.